For Mauhan Zonoozy, an executive with a storied career that includes stints at Spotify as Global Head of Innovation, his portfolio site was about to become the talk of the town. With the help of design studio Vicine, Zonoozy's website took a bold turn that would challenge traditional notions of personal branding and social media sharing.
The design studio, known for its innovative approach to web development, was approached by Zonoozy with an unconventional request. He wanted a portfolio site that didn't just showcase his work, but also felt like a dynamic, living experience – much like a Google Meet call. The idea was met with excitement and curiosity at Vicine, who jumped at the opportunity to create something truly unique. With their expertise in user experience design, the studio set out to craft a site that would not only showcase Zonoozy's work but also provide an immersive experience for visitors.
A Breakthrough Success
The result was nothing short of astonishing. Within hours of launching the website, it had reached over a million impressions on Instagram alone. The real magic happened when visitors began sharing screengrabs of what appeared to be a non-stop Google Meet call – without realizing it was actually Zonoozy's portfolio site masquerading as a conference call. Word spread like wildfire, and soon the website was flooded with comments and messages from people eager to know more about the "mysterious" tech executive and his innovative approach to personal branding.
